Choosing the Best Toys for Babies (0-12 months)

During the first year of life, babies are rapidly absorbing the world around them, making it crucial to offer toys that stimulate their senses and support their growth. Here's how we ensure you pick the perfect playthings for your little ones:

Importance of sensory stimulation and exploration during infancy

Babies are like little sponges, soaking up everything they see, hear, touch, and taste. Sensory stimulation is vital during infancy as it helps babies learn about their surroundings and develop essential skills. Toys that engage their senses can enhance cognitive development, promote motor skills, and foster emotional well-being.

Key considerations when selecting toys for babies

When choosing toys for babies, safety is paramount. Opt for toys made from non-toxic materials and avoid small parts that could pose a choking hazard. Additionally, look for toys that are age-appropriate and encourage interaction and exploration. Babies are naturally curious, so toys with varying textures, bright colors, and interesting sounds are sure to captivate their attention.

Top recommended toys for babies

  1. Different natural textures: Babies love to touch and explore different textures. Soft plush toys, wooden blocks, and fabric books are excellent choices for stimulating their sense of touch and encouraging sensory exploration.

  2. High-contrast color toys: Contrasting colors like black and white are visually stimulating for newborns and help strengthen their developing eyesight. Look for books, mobiles, and toys with bold patterns to capture their attention.

  3. Rattles and graspable toys: Toys that are easy for babies to grasp and manipulate are perfect for developing their hand-eye coordination and fine motor skills. Rattles, teethers, and simple wooden toys are great options for little hands to explore.

  4. Teething toys made from natural materials: Teething can be a challenging time for both babies and parents, but providing safe and soothing teething toys can help alleviate discomfort. Look for teething toys made from natural materials like organic cotton or untreated wood, as they are gentle on babies' sensitive gums.

 

 

Best Toys for Toddlers (1-3 years)

Toddler Development Milestones and Toy Preferences

Toddlers are in a phase of rapid development, marked by newfound mobility, language acquisition, and burgeoning independence. They are curious explorers, eager to interact with their environment and engage in imaginative play. Understanding these developmental milestones is crucial in selecting toys that both entertain and support their growth.

Safety Considerations for Toddlers' Toys

When choosing toys for toddlers, it's essential to prioritize safety features such as non-toxic materials, sturdy construction, and age-appropriate design. Avoid toys with small parts that could pose a choking hazard and ensure that any electronic toys meet stringent safety standards.

Top Recommended Toys for Toddlers

  1. Shape Sorters and Stacking Toys: These classic toys help toddlers develop fine motor skills, hand-eye coordination, and shape recognition. As they fit colorful shapes into corresponding slots or stack blocks to build towers, toddlers learn about spatial relationships and problem-solving.

  2. Playsets for Imaginative Play: Fuel your toddler's creativity with playsets that transport them to imaginative worlds. From miniature kitchens and tool benches to dollhouses and farm sets, these toys encourage pretend play, social interaction, and storytelling skills.

  3. Musical Instruments for Sensory Exploration: Introduce your little one to the joy of music with age-appropriate instruments like tambourines, xylophones, and shakers. Musical toys stimulate auditory senses, rhythm awareness, and fine motor skills as toddlers experiment with sounds and rhythms.

  4. Simple Puzzles and Matching Games: Engage your toddler's cognitive skills with puzzles and matching games designed for their age group. These activities promote problem-solving, spatial awareness, and shape recognition while providing a sense of accomplishment as toddlers complete each puzzle or match.

  5. Ride-On Toys for Physical Activity: Encourage active play and gross motor development with ride-on toys such as balance bikes, tricycles, and scooters. These toys not only provide hours of entertainment but also help toddlers improve balance, coordination, and spatial awareness.

Ideal Toys for Kids (4-8 years)

Cognitive and social development in early childhood

As children transition from toddlers to early childhood, their cognitive and social skills undergo significant development. Toys play a crucial role in fostering these advancements by providing opportunities for exploration, problem-solving, and interaction with others.

Top Recommended Toys for Kids

  1. Building Blocks and Construction Sets: Building blocks and construction sets are timeless classics that promote spatial awareness, fine motor skills, and creativity. Kids can build anything their imagination desires, from towering skyscrapers to intricate castles.

  2. Art Supplies for Creative Expression: Fuel your child's creativity with art supplies like crayons, markers, paints, and modeling clay. Artistic activities not only allow kids to express themselves but also help develop fine motor skills and visual-spatial reasoning.

  3. Science Kits and STEM Toys for Learning Through Experimentation: Encourage a love for science, technology, engineering, and mathematics (STEM) with hands-on science kits and STEM toys. These engaging activities promote curiosity, problem-solving, and critical thinking skills.

  4. Outdoor Toys like Bikes, Scooters, and Sports Equipment: Outdoor play is essential for physical development and overall well-being. Provide kids with bikes, scooters, balls, and other sports equipment to encourage active play and exploration of the great outdoors.

  5. Role-Playing Sets for Imaginative Play: Foster creativity and social skills with role-playing sets such as play kitchens, doctor kits, and dress-up costumes. Role-playing allows kids to explore different roles and scenarios, developing empathy and communication skills along the way.

  6. Books and Storytelling Toys to Foster Literacy Skills: Cultivate a lifelong love for reading with a diverse selection of books and storytelling toys. Reading aloud to children and engaging in storytelling activities helps develop language skills, expands vocabulary, and sparks imagination.
